The sweetest Christmas table by Tracey Lau Art & Soul

Want to see something that would even make the Grinch’s heart grow a couple of sizes? Check out these teeny, tiny, utterly adorable wreaths – they’re perfection!

These little beauties are the handiwork of the enviably talented Tracey Lau of Tracey Lau Art & Soul. They’re part of a gorgeous holiday table that she put together for a corporate client (that’s one lucky company!).

I adore the classic red and white color scheme, and all the little bows are so super-sweet. And the little triangular bon-bons? Sections of Toblerones, wrapped up in paper. A fabulous idea!
